Abstract

The availability of safe and adequate blood supply is a critical component of modern healthcare systems. Blood banks play a vital role in collecting, storing, and distributing blood to patients in need. However, traditional blood bank management systems often rely on manual processes, leading to inefficiencies, delays, and errors in donor–recipient matching and inventory management. This research presents a web-based Blood Bank Management System designed to improve operational efficiency, ensure real-time availability tracking, and facilitate effective communication between donors, recipients, and administrators. The proposed system is developed using Python and the Django web framework, providing a scalable and secure platform for managing blood bank operations. It enables users to register as donors, search for available blood types, and request blood units during emergencies. The system maintains a centralized database that stores donor information, blood inventory, and transaction records.The system incorporates features such as real-time inventory updates, donor eligibility tracking, and automated notifications. These functionalities ensure that blood availability information is always up-to-date and accessible. The system also supports role-based access control, allowing administrators to manage data securely while providing limited access to users.Data validation and error handling mechanisms are implemented to ensure data integrity and system reliability. The web-based architecture allows users to access the system from any location, improving accessibility and response time during emergencies. The proposed system addresses the limitations of traditional blood bank management approaches by automating key processes and reducing human intervention. It enhances transparency, reduces operational costs, and improves service quality.Experimental evaluation demonstrates that the system effectively manages blood inventory and reduces response time in emergency situations. The integration of modern web technologies ensures scalability and ease of maintenance.This research contributes to healthcare informatics by providing a practical and efficient solution for blood bank management. Future work may involve integrating machine learning techniques for demand prediction and incorporating mobile applications to further enhance accessibility.
